Lianyungang Huaguoshan International Airport (LYG) is a premier aviation facility in Jiangsu Province, China, which officially commenced operations in December 2021. Replacing the older Baitabu Airport, the new facility serves as a critical strategic node for the 'Belt and Road' initiative, anchoring the eastern terminus of the New Eurasian Land Bridge. Its primary 2,800-meter asphalt runway is designed to handle narrow-body jet aircraft, providing essential domestic and regional international connectivity for Lianyungang's major seaport and the surrounding economic development zones. The centerpiece of the airport is a state-of-the-art passenger terminal covering approximately 30,000 square meters, designed to accommodate an annual throughput of 2.5 million travelers. The facility features a unified layout that simplifies transit for both domestic and international passengers, with a central check-in hall, multiple boarding gates, and streamlined security checkpoints. Inside, amenities are focused on modern traveler comfort, including dedicated VIP and business lounges, nursery rooms for families, and a diverse range of cafes and retail outlets offering local Jiangsu specialties alongside international fast-food brands. Transportation to and from Huaguoshan International is highly efficient, situated approximately 21.5 kilometers southeast of the Lianyungang city center in Guanyun County. Dedicated airport shuttle buses provide synchronized transfers to the main railway station and major downtown points, with a travel time of roughly 50 to 70 minutes. For those requiring private transit, official taxi and ride-hailing ranks are situated directly outside the arrivals hall, offering a swift 40-minute commute to the urban core.
